Forrest Frank's single 'Jesus Is Alive!' vaults to the top of Billboard's Hot Christian Songs chart after a massive 199% streaming increase, fueled by a viral social media challenge. The song's two-week climb to number one places it among an elite group in the chart's modern era.
Forrest Frank 's ' Jesus Is Alive !
' soared 16 positions to claim the number one spot on Billboard's Hot Christian Songs chart for the week dated May 30. The track achieved this feat after recording 3 million official U.S. streams, a surge of 199% during the May 15-21 tracking period, according to data from Luminate. This marks Frank's 70th career entry on the chart and his tenth top 10 hit.
The song's rapid ascent to the summit is historically significant; in the modern era since the chart's 2012 shift to a multimetric methodology, only three other songs have reached number one as quickly. Those precedents are Reba McEntire and Lauren Daigle's 'Back to God' in 2017, and MercyMe's 'I Can Only Imagine' and Daigle's 'You Say' in 2018, with the latter going on to set a record with 132 weeks at number one. A key driver for 'Jesus Is Alive!
' has been a viral social media challenge that encouraged fans and fellow artists to create and share their own verses, transforming the release into a collaborative, multi-version project. This community engagement strategy helped propel the song beyond a traditional single rollout. The expanded edition now features over 20 versions, including contributions from Donnie Wahlberg, rapper 1K Phew, Nigerian artist Limoblaze, and Pastor Marcus Rogers, among others.
Frank first gained prominence as one half of the pop duo Surfaces before establishing himself as a leading crossover figure in contemporary Christian music. His sound blends pop, hip-hop, and worship elements, and he frequently employs a social-first release strategy to connect with audiences. His 2024 album 'California Cowboy' further cemented his unique style and broad appeal. Building on this momentum, Frank is set to launch his 'The Jesus Generation Tour' on June 1 in Tulsa, Oklahoma.
The tour will make stops in major markets including Detroit, New York, Charlotte, North Carolina, Nashville, and Los Angeles. He will be supported by special guests Tori Kelly, Cory Asbury, and the band The Figs, promising a major live experience for fans nationwide
